. Choose the correct answer
1. The equation of circle with center at origin and radius 5 units is:
a) x2+y2=25 b) x2+y2=5 c) x2=25 d) y2=25
2. The equation of circle with center at (2, 5) and radius 5 units is:
a) x2+y2+4x-10y+4=0 b) x2+y2-4x-10y+4=0
c) x2+y2+4x+10y+4=0 d) x2+y2+4x-10y-4=0
3. The Centre of the circle with equation x2+y2-4x-10y+4=0 is:
a) (-2, 5) b) (-2, -5) c) (2, -5) d) (2, 5)
4. The radius of the circle with equation x2+y2-4x-10y+4=0 is:
a) 25 units b) 20 units c) 5 units d) 10 units
5. The point (1, 4) lie ___________ the circle x2+y2-2x-4y+2=0.
a) inside circle b) outside circle c) on the circle d) either inside or outside
Answer the following questions
6. Find the equation of the parabola with focus (5, 0) and directrix x = -5.
7. Find the equation of the ellipse that satisfies given conditions:
Vertices (±6, 0), foci (±4, 0).
8. Find the coordinates of the foci, the vertices, the length of major axis, the minor axis,
the eccentricity and the length of the latus rectum of the ellipse 4x2 +9y2=36.
9. Find the equation of the circle concentric with the circle x2 + y2 + 4x + 6y + 11 = 0
and passing through the point (5, 4).
